Features of Aviator App
1. Flight Planning: Aviator App allows you to plan your flights with ease by providing detailed information about your route, weather conditions, and airspace restrictions. You can also create a flight log to keep track of your progress.
2. Navigation Tools: The app offers a variety of navigation tools to help you stay on course, including GPS tracking, VOR and NDB navigation, and flight alerts. You can also access real-time weather updates and airport information.
3. Checklists: Aviator App comes with a built-in checklist feature that allows you to easily go through pre-flight, in-flight, and post-flight procedures. This helps ensure that you don’t miss any important steps before taking off.
4. Flight Simulations: One of the unique features of Aviator App is its flight simulation capabilities. You can practice your flying skills in a virtual environment before taking to the skies, helping you improve your piloting abilities.
5. Community Support: Aviator App has a thriving online community where users can share tips, ask questions, and connect with other pilots. This can be a valuable resource for beginner pilots looking for guidance and advice.
Getting Started with Aviator App
To start using Aviator App, simply download the application from the App Store or Google Play Store and create an account. Once you have logged in, you can start exploring the various features and tools available to you.
1. Setting Up Your Profile: The first step is to set up your profile by entering your personal information, including your name, email address, and pilot’s license number (if applicable). This will help personalize your experience with the app.
2. Exploring the Dashboard: The dashboard is where you will find all the essential tools and information you need for your flights. Take some time to familiarize yourself with the layout and navigation of the app.
3. Planning Your First Flight: To plan your first flight, enter your departure and destination airports, and the app will generate a detailed flight plan for you. You can customize your route and add waypoints as needed.
4. Using Navigation Tools: As you fly, use the Aviator Predictor navigation tools provided in Aviator App to stay on course and avoid any potential hazards. Familiarize yourself with how to read GPS coordinates, VORs, and NDBs to navigate effectively.
5. Completing Your Flight Log: After landing, don’t forget to complete your flight log in Aviator App. This will help you keep track of your flying hours, distances traveled, and any issues encountered during the flight.
